Precision TIG welded brackets ensuring correct block alignment
The heart of this LS engine swap kit is a set of steel brackets assembled with TIG welding, a process prized for deep weld penetration and minimal heat distortion. After welding, each bracket undergoes precision machining to return the LS block to its factory orientation, eliminating the guessing game often encountered when fitting modern engines into classic GM trucks. Restoring exact block angle is crucial for consistent gear engagement and even load distribution across universal joints, which in turn reduces vibration and extends driveline life. Whether paired with a manual T56 or an automatic 4L60E, 4L80E, or 6L80E transmission, these brackets lock the powerplant firmly in place under heavy acceleration or towing. The result is a stable foundation that preserves drivetrain geometry and promotes reliable shifting and power delivery over thousands of miles.
Engine mounts with molded polyurethane isolating vibration and angle shift
Traditional rubber bushings can compress and deteriorate under high torque, but the kit's molded polyurethane mounts resist deformation to preserve the precise relationship between engine and transmission. By isolating road and engine vibrations, they reduce cabin noise and harshness without sacrificing support for the drivetrain. These mounts are designed to maintain correct driveline angle through hard launches or heavy loads, preventing angle drift that can lead to premature universal joint failure. A clearly labeled hardware pack pairs each spacer and bolt with its corresponding bracket, streamlining the mock assembly and final torque stages. The combination of rigidity and resilience delivers a smoother driving experience and protects critical driveline components in both daily commuting and trail hauling.
Direct fit transmission crossmember matching factory frame points
The included transmission crossmember and support brackets bolt directly to the original frame rails and bellhousing without any tunnel modification. Predrilled hole patterns align precisely with GM mounting points, preserving the driveshaft angle and avoiding the misalignment that can sap power and damage joints. All fasteners are Grade 8 hardware, and each piece is labeled to guide builders from initial trial fit through final torque settings in a single session. By retaining the stock floor pan and frame structure, this solution maintains chassis rigidity and allows for seamless routing of exhaust or other accessories. Installers gain confidence in a system that slots into place with factory-style accuracy, ensuring long-term durability and ease of service.
Oil pan clearance geometry optimized for Gen III and IV LS variants
This swap kit's frame brackets are sculpted to provide generous rail-to-pan spacing, accommodating everything from low‐profile street pans to deep sump high capacity designs. Support for popular aftermarket solutions such as Moroso high clearance pans or the LH8 oil pan means builders can tailor oil capacity and pickup reliability to their use case, whether street performance or heavy-duty towing. The clearance geometry ensures reliable oil flow under steep cornering or uneven terrain, preventing starvation and protecting bearings under sustained load. By maintaining consistent crankcase orientation, the design delivers stable oil pressure in all conditions and preserves engine health across a wide range of Gen III and Gen IV platforms from LS1 through LQ9.
